IEEE international conference to be held at Sahyadri College from Nov 21-22


Media Release

Mangaluru, Nov 19: IEEE Second International Conference on Computing, Semiconductor, Mechatronics, Intelligent Systems and Communications (COSMIC-2025) will be held on November 21-22, in the serene premises of Sahyadri College of Engineering & Management in the region of Mangaluru.

Sahyadri has always prioritized research and innovation through various initiatives, including Synergia, Social Innovation Projects, the Sahyadri science talent hunt, and hosting prominent conferences. The COSMIC-2025, one of Sahyadri's flagship events, will take place in the college campus in Mangaluru, Karnataka, India and is supported by the IEEE Bangalore Section. This international conference is set to draw experts and enthusiasts from diverse fields including computing, semiconductor, mechatronics, intelligent systems, and communications.

COSMIC-2025 aims to provide a platform for researchers, academicians, industry professionals, and students to come together and engage in a meaningful exchange of ideas for carrying multidisciplinary research. The conference will feature keynote addresses, technical paper presentations, and poster sessions, all designed to promote the dissemination of research findings and innovative solutions. All accepted and presented papers will be submitted for potential publication in the IEEE Xplore® Digital Library (Conference Record #67569), through the IEEE Conference Publications Program (CPP).

This marks the third IEEE international conference hosted by Sahyadri College of Engineering and Management. Last year, we successfully organized the IEEE COSMIC-2024, and in 2023, organized IEEE DISCOVER-2023 in collaboration with the IEEE Mangalore Subsection and IEEE Bangalore Section, further solidifying our commitment to advancing technology and research. We look forward to the vibrant discussions and collaborations that COSMIC-2025 will inspire.

Overall, 400 papers were submitted to the conference from the various locations in the country and abroad, out of which 20% were accepted for presentation during the conference, after scrutiny through double-blind multiple reviews. We are expecting an audience of approximately 200+ attendees, participants and delegates from diverse locations.
